Design for Mobile 2009 conference

design for mobile

Design For Mobile is the first and only North American mobile user experience conference. This is a two-day conference focused on strategy and tactics for user research, product definition, interaction and other design, and usability testing. A day of workshops precede the conference sessions.

Event Time: April 20-22, 2009

Adobe Flash Player 10 critical Update for Flash CS4 Professional!

Adobe released an important update for Adobe Flash Player 10 Update for Flash CS4 Professional!

“This download contains fixes for critical vulnerabilities identified in Security Bulletin APSB09-01 Flash Player update available to address security vulnerabilities. The update replaces the Debug and Release versions of Flash Player 10 browser plugins and standalone players that are included in the initial release of Flash CS4 Professional (player version 10.0.2.54). All users are encouraged to apply this update. These new players are version 10.0.22.87.”

Video: Introduction to Adobe’s mobile packager

A step by step video tutorial of Adobe’s mobile packager for distributing your Flash lite content by Serge Jespers.
“you can now package your application using the Mobile Packager and distribute your application as an SIS-file for Symbian S60 or CAB-file for Window Mobile phones. Your users can now download and install your Flash based application on their mobile device just like any other application they install. What’s even cooler is that we also package a Flash Version Checker together with your application. As soon as the user launches the application, the Flash Version Checker is going to check if the Flash Player is installed and if it is the correct version. If not, it’s going to download and install the Flash Lite runtime seamlessly.”

Microsoft’s announced new version of Windows Mobile with Adobe Flash lite 3.1

Microsoft’s announced at the Mobile World Congress, Barcelona that newer version of Windows Mobile is with adobe Flash Lite 3.1

“What people really want is PC-style browsing on the phone. … There’s all these stats whereby if you tell users, go to the most popular sites and do something, they have this success and failure rate of whether they can do it on different mobile smart phones. With Internet Explorer, our rendering, how the UI looks, it is much more accurate to the PC because it’s the PC browser.”

“Then, by including Flash Lite in there, it also helps if you have a Flash site. Some of them use Flash actually as core navigation and functionality. So it’s not all eye candy. If you go to a site like that, at least you can go find the information and interact with it. The bigger news isn’t about Flash Lite, the bigger news is about getting PC-quality browsing on your phone.”

Adobe Releases Distributable Flash Lite 3.1 Player

distributableplayer.jpg

distributableplayer_workflow.jpg

Adobe released the most excited stuff for Adobe Flash Lite developer “redistributable version of the Flash Lite 3.1 player along with the packager tool”. You really don’t need to worry about whether someone has the player, and being helpless to get them it if they haven’t. 🙂

The distributable player solution enables developers to create rich applications for the latest version of Adobe® Flash Lite™ and directly distribute their content to millions of open OS smartphones, providing a better on-device user experience.

Currently this solution is available only in few selected cities like India, Italy, Spain, UK, and the U.S. can easily download applications. (additional countries will be added over time.) After downloading an application, consumers see its user-friendly icon in the device menu.

Nokia launches IdeasProject.com “Do you have any idea” :)

ideas project

Nokia has launched IdeasProject, an online information space designed to help people find and understand the connections between thought leaders and their big ideas.

“IdeasProject is an exciting new way to highlight big ideas from leading thinkers, and to show how so many new thoughts are connected to one another,” said Loic Le Meur, Founder, Seesmic and LeWeb conference. Le Meur’s “big idea” on IdeasProject is that “Sharing changes everything.”

“IdeasProject visitors can see new ideas as they surface and be able to track the connection between ideas and the thought leaders that contributed them,” said Valerie Buckingham, Director of Technology Marketing, Nokia.
